1And the child Samuel ministered unto Jehovah before Eli. And the word of Jehovah was precious in those days; there was no frequent vision.

1The boy Samuel served the LORD under the supervision of Eli. In those days messages from the LORD were rare, and visions were not common.

2And it came to pass at that time, when Eli was laid down in his place (now his eyes had begun to wax dim, so that he could not see),

2One night Eli, whose eyesight was failing so that he could hardly see, was lying down in his usual place.

3and the lamp of God was not yet gone out, and Samuel was laid down to sleep, in the temple of Jehovah, where the ark of God was;

3The lamp of God had not yet gone out, and Samuel was sleeping in the temple of the LORD where the chest of God was kept.

4that Jehovah called Samuel: and he said, Here am I.

4The LORD called Samuel, and Samuel answered, 'I am here.'

5And he ran unto Eli, and said, Here am I; for thou calledst me. And he said, I called not; lie down again. And he went and lay down.

5He ran to Eli and said, 'I am here; you called me.' But Eli said, 'I did not call you; go back and lie down.' So Samuel went and lay down.

6And Jehovah called yet again, Samuel. And Samuel arose and went to Eli, and said, Here am I; for thou calledst me. And he answered, I called not, my son; lie down again.

6The LORD called again, 'Samuel!' Samuel got up and went to Eli and said, 'I am here; you called me.' Eli answered, 'I didn't call you, my son; go back and lie down.'

7Now Samuel did not yet know Jehovah, neither was the word of Jehovah yet revealed unto him.

7Now Samuel did not yet know the LORD, and the word of the LORD had not yet been revealed to him.

8And Jehovah called Samuel again the third time. And he arose and went to Eli, and said, Here am I; for thou calledst me. And Eli perceived that Jehovah had called the child.

8The LORD called Samuel a third time. He got up, went to Eli, and said, 'I am here; you called me.' Then Eli realized that the LORD was calling the boy.

9Therefore Eli said unto Samuel, Go, lie down: and it shall be, if he call thee, that thou shalt say, Speak, Jehovah; for thy servant heareth. So Samuel went and lay down in his place.

9So Eli told Samuel, 'Go and lie down. If he calls you again, say, 'Speak, LORD, for your servant is listening.' So Samuel went and lay down in his place.

10And Jehovah came, and stood, and called as at other times, Samuel, Samuel. Then Samuel said, Speak; for thy servant heareth.

10The LORD came and stood there, calling as he had before, 'Samuel! Samuel!' Then Samuel said, 'Speak, for your servant is listening.'

11And Jehovah said to Samuel, Behold, I will do a thing in Israel, at which both the ears of every one that heareth it shall tingle.

11The LORD said to Samuel, 'Look, I am about to do something in Israel that will make the ears of everyone who hears about it ring.'

12In that day I will perform against Eli all that I have spoken concerning his house, from the beginning even unto the end.

12'At that time I will carry out against Eli everything I warned him about regarding his family, from beginning to end.'

13For I have told him that I will judge his house for ever, for the iniquity which he knew, because his sons did bring a curse upon themselves, and he restrained them not.

13'I told him that I would judge his family forever because of the sin he knew about; his sons made themselves a curse, and he did not stop them.'

14And therefore I have sworn unto the house of Eli, that the iniquity of Eli’s house shall not be expiated with sacrifice nor offering for ever.

14'Therefore, I swore to the family of Eli that the sin of his house will never be forgiven by sacrifices or offerings.'

15And Samuel lay until the morning, and opened the doors of the house of Jehovah. And Samuel feared to show Eli the vision.

15Samuel stayed in bed until morning and then opened the doors of the house of the LORD. He was afraid to tell Eli about the vision.

16Then Eli called Samuel, and said, Samuel, my son. And he said, Here am I.

16But Eli called him and said, 'Samuel, my son.' Samuel answered, 'I am here.'

17And he said, What is the thing thatJehovah hath spoken unto thee? I pray thee, hide it not from me: God do so to thee, and more also, if thou hide anything from me of all the things that he spake unto thee.

17Eli asked, 'What was the message he gave you? Please do not hide it from me. May God punish you severely if you hide any part of what he told you.'

18And Samuel told him every whit, and hid nothing from him. And he said, It is Jehovah: let him do what seemeth him good.

18So Samuel told him everything and did not hide anything. Eli said, 'He is the LORD; let him do what he thinks is best.'

19And Samuel grew, and Jehovah was with him, and did let none of his words fall to the ground.

19As Samuel grew up, the LORD was with him and made sure that none of Samuel's prophecies failed to come true.

20And all Israel from Dan even to Beer-sheba knew that Samuel was established to be a prophet of Jehovah.

20All the people of Israel from Dan to Beersheba recognized that Samuel was confirmed as a prophet of the LORD.

21And Jehovah appeared again in Shiloh; for Jehovah revealed himself to Samuel in Shiloh by the word of Jehovah.

21The LORD continued to appear at Shiloh, because he revealed himself to Samuel there through his word.
